Weather July 29, 1927

The temperature on July 29, 1927 was between 9.3 °C and 21.7 °C and averaged 16.5 °C. There was 0.1 mm of rain. There was 10.4 hours of sunshine (66%). The average windspeed was 3 Bft (moderate breeze) and was prevailing from the south-southwest.
